EQUIPPED is the podcast that turns gaming concepts into life lessons. Learn about different ways you can clear quests, fight boss battles, and level up, not only IN-GAME but also IN REAL LIFE.

You’re going to fall in love with this podcast. Iza’s optimistic and insightful perspective on gaming’s “life lessons” are genuine, heartwarming, and inspirational. From sharing personal anecdotes of fumbling through The Witcher 3, to applying gaming concepts like “AOE” in our daily lives, she seamlessly navigates between in-game and IRL experiences with a refreshingly fun and well-articulated tone. Highly recommend for fans of gaming and motivational listening!
